What forks are these
Did a bunch of reading last nite, and realized these forks are not factory for this bike(01 kdx200 ), as they are upside down. Any ideas?

Re: What forks are these
1999, 2000, 2001, 2002 or 2003 KX125 or KX250.
Measure the fork diameter or post the rim codes if you have a KX wheel.
They are not 1999 - 2001 KX125 clamps due to the handlebar mounts.

What forks are these
Lower fork tube is 46mm, upper is just about 56mm

Re: What forks are these
That rules out 2002 and newer, so 1999, 2000 or 2001. What size are the clamp bolt heads? They changed to 10 mm in 2000 or 2001. Is the steering stem tapered?

Re: What forks are these
Brake pads are the same as well. Also, same brakes as the KDX came with. Take the bearings out, go to a local bearing supplier and get bearings from them. The only thing that you really need to worry about is the parts that actually go in/on the forks.

Re: What forks are these
99-01 KX250 is most likely given the top triple. Internally the same as the 125 other than spring weights and damping. The 125/250 for those years use the same seals and guides. They are an improvement over the stock forks but still need to be sprung for your riding weight.
